State true or false.


If two equal chords AB and CD of a circle when produced intersect at a point P. Then PB = PD.


  1. A
    True
  2. B
    False

    Solution:

    Given that, two equal chords AB and CD of a circle intersect at a point P when produced.
    Creating figures using given data. Now Joining OP and drawing OL  AB and OM  CD.
    In ΔOLP and ΔOMP  ,
    OL=OM                        (Equal chords are equidistant from the center)
     OLP =  OMP = 90 °   (From figure)
     OP=OP                        (Common side)
    By RHS congruence rule, Δ  OLP Δ  OMP .
    And by C.P.CT. we have,
    LP=MP And AB=CD.
    Divide above relation by 2 from both sides,
    Since, the perpendicular distance from center to the circle bisects the chord, BL= 1 2 AB   And DM= 1 2 CD   .
    Now using equation 2 we have,
    BL=DM  Subtracting equation (3) from equation (1). Then we get,
    LP-BL=MP-DM
     PB=PD
    Thus, option 1 is correct.
